Description
The human figure is a classic artistic subject - beautiful, inspiring, and challenging to draw. This sourcebook shows the various ways of seeing the figure and offers instruction, advice, and visual inspiration. It also includes tips and techniques on proportion and basic anatomy and the details of the human form.
There is an invaluable photographic reference source for a variety of poses and features. This book will help you to shape your own approach and individual style, and allow you to better understand and portray the human body.

Author's Bio
Simon Jennings trained as a graphic artist and is a graduate of the Royal College of Art in London. He has taught at several British art schools, including the Royal College of Art. He has conceived, designed and produced many art and design titles, including the award-winning Collins Artist's Manual and Collins Art Class.
